About Batee Meuduro

Batee Meuduro is situated 70 minutes away on the south side of Pulau Weh. This dive is definitely one of Pulau Weh's top dive sites, but due to it's distance, it is mostly operated as a 2 tank daytrip. The visibility is generally very good here and the often fierce currents around this pinnacle attract lots of pelagics. You might even get to see the amazing Thresher sharks! The shallow plateau is covered with huge table corals.
